Part-time Description Sycamore Development Partners is seeking a proactive and organized Office Administrator to join our team in Brea, CA. This is eligible for hybrid work, working Monday through Thursday in the office with the option to work remotely on Friday. The Office Administrator will play a vital role in providing administrative and clerical support, managing daily office operations, and coordinating team and office scheduling. The successful candidate will contribute to enhancing team productivity by ensuring smooth and efficient office functioning. Job Objectives:
  • Streamline Processes: Enhance team productivity and efficiency by streamlining office processes and procedures.
  • Optimize Workflow: Implement time-saving strategies and tools to optimize workflow and minimize administrative overhead.
  • Facilitate Communication: Implement communication tools, protocols, and system to enhance communication and collaboration among team members and departments.
  • Enhance Communication: Ensure timely dissemination of information and updates through improved internal communication channels and platforms.
Roles and Responsibilities:
  • Administrative Support: Provide administrative and clerical support, including drafting correspondence, managing emails, scheduling appointments, and organizing files and documents.
  • Data Management: Assist with data entry, record-keeping, and maintaining office supplies and equipment inventory.
  • Daily Operations: Oversee daily office operations, including managing incoming and outgoing mail, answering phone calls, and greeting visitors.
  • Financial Asset Management: Safely land and manage cash transactions, including deposits and withdrawals. Process and manage checks, ensuring timely deposits and record-keeping. Maintain and manage company credit cards, including monitoring expenditures and ensuring proper usage. Safeguard and manage keys to secure company assets and facilities.
  • Office Maintenance: Ensure office orderliness and safety by coordinating maintenance, repairs, and facility management tasks.
  • Scheduling: Coordinate team and office scheduling, including meetings, appointments, and conference room reservations.
  • Communication: Communicate scheduling changes and updates to team members and stakeholders as needed.
  • Vendor Coordination: Liaise with vendors and service providers to coordinate deliveries, repairs, and maintenance services for office equipment and facilities.
  • Travel Arrangements: Assist with travel arrangements for team members, including booking flights, accommodations, and transportation as needed.
  • Event Planning: Support the planning and coordination of office events, meetings, and gatherings, including logistics, catering, and attendee management.
  • Accounting Support: Assist with invoicing, expenses, and basic accounting tasks as needed.
  • Executive Assistance: Provide administrative support to the Senior Vice President, including booking travel and managing meetings.
